Unit substitution problems are increasingly being used in middle school and high school math curricula across the United States. This shift is driven by the need for students to develop stronger algebraic skills and apply mathematical concepts to real-world problems. As a result, educators and students are seeking effective strategies to tackle unit substitution problems with confidence.

How it Works
Unit substitution problems involve expressing a given numerical value in terms of a new unit. This is achieved by multiplying or dividing the original value by the conversion factor, which represents the relationship between the two units. For example, if you want to convert 5 miles to kilometers, you would multiply 5 by the conversion factor of 1.6 kilometers per mile.
